How do you pay a credit card bill and can I pay credit card bill with credit card?

Yes, you will be able to pay one credit card bill with another credit card. There are a couple of different ways to do this: 1. Balance transfer - There are credit cards that would let you transfer some of the the balance from one card to another. The interest for this transfer is usually lesser on the transferred balance. 2. Using Credit Card Checks - You can also use the checks that come with some credit cards. All you've got to do is write a check for the amount due. This transaction does not carry any additional charges along with it. 3. Cash Advance - There is also a possibility of getting a cash advance from a credit card and this can be deposited into your savings account or even used to pay the bill of another credit card.


Is there any method other than check payment to pay off credit card bills?

Depending on the credit card you might be able to pay by * a cash lodgement at your bank branch, or * by telebanking (I pay my credit card over the internet, by transferring money each month from my current account to pay the bill), or * you might be able to pay by direct debit. Many credit card companies allow online payment of bills. If your banker and credit card issuer are the same, then there should be an option for automatic transfer of funds when the bills are due. You could also pay your credit card bill with a debit card or through cash, I suppose.

Is credit card a cash transaction?

Purchase with a credit card is not considered a cash transaction, as the person making the purchase does not pay for the item until they pay their credit card bill, which may not occur until much later.

What is the difference between a debit card and a credit card?

A debit card takes money directly from your account. A credit card takes the money from the credit card company, and the credit card company will bill you in monthly installments until you pay them back (plus interest). A debit card is like paying in cash, without actually having the cash on you. A credit card is similar to taking a small loan.

Where can one pay a credit card bill online?

If one wishes to pay a credit card bill online there are a few options. Usually one can pay a credit bill online through ones online banking account. There are also options for one to pay a credit card bill online through the site for the specific card.


How many ways are there to pay credit card bills?

You can pay your credit card bill by check through the mail, use your bank accounts bill pay system to pay electronically or use a debit card to pay by phone or on the credit card companies website.
